思考工具:对随时间变化的时间灵敏度.

Na Zhu1, Jia Huang2, YouSong Su2

  • 1Shanghai Pudong New Area Mental Health Center, Tongji University School of Medicine, Shanghai, China.

BMC psychiatry
|October 30, 2024
PubMed
概括

双极性抑郁症 (BD-D) 的认知功能障碍很常见,但THINC-it工具显示,在中国患者中,随着时间的推移,认知功能障碍保持稳定. 这种经过验证的工具可靠地测量BD-D的认知变化,将受影响的个体与健康的对照区分开来.

背景情况:

  • 认知功能障碍是双极性抑郁症 (BD-D) 的核心特征,但其评估和治疗仍然有限.
  • 评估对认知功能变化的时间敏感性对于理解BD-D进展和治疗疗效至关重要.
  • 在临床环境中,THINC-it工具是持续和可靠的认知评估的潜在工具.

研究的目的:

  • 纵向评估THINC-it工具在中国双极抑郁症患者队列中的时间灵敏度和可靠性.
  • 通过使用THINC-it工具,评估BD-D患者的认知功能的稳定性.
  • 确定THINC-it工具是否可以可靠地区分BD-D患者和健康对照者之间的认知障碍.

主要方法:

  • 一项纵向临床试验,涉及120名BD-D患者和100名健康对照 (HC).
  • 参与者在8周内使用THINC-it工具进行评估,同时使用17项汉密尔顿抑郁症评分表 (HAMD-17) 和年轻狂热评分表 (YMRS).
  • 进行了心理测量分析,包括一般线性模型和纵向分析,控制了诸如年龄,性别,教育和HAMD-17分数等混因素.

主要成果:

  • 在8周的时间内,在BD-D患者中没有发现认知功能变异的显著时间相关差异 (P > 0.05).
  • 纵向分析证实,经过调整以考虑混因素 (P > 0.05) 后,认知障碍随时间推移没有显著变化.
  • 在几个THINC-it子测试 (Spotter,Codebreaker,Trails,PDQ-5-D) 和总复合得分 (P <0.05) 中,在BD-D患者和HC患者之间观察到认知表现的显著差异.

结论:

  • 在中国双极抑郁症患者中,THINC-it工具证明了时间稳定性和对认知功能的群体差异的敏感性.
  • 这些发现支持THINC-it工具的可行性和可靠性,用于BD-D的代认知评估.
  • 这项研究强调了THINC-it工具在识别和监测BD-D认知功能障碍方面的实用性,有助于临床评估和治疗策略.
